CodeWarrior编程入门与调试教程详解

1星 需积分: 10 15 下载量 158 浏览量 更新于2024-08-02 收藏 2.3MB PDF 举报
CodeWarrior使用教程是一份针对C/C++编程的全面指南,专为Windows平台设计,旨在帮助开发者提高效率并解决编程过程中常见的问题。该教程由CodeWarrior官方或认可的来源提供,分为七个核心课程: 1. **第一课:认识CodeWarrior** - 这部分介绍了CodeWarrior的功能和优势,它能帮助程序员检测并修复代码中的错误,通过集成的调试器和编辑器提供实时反馈,使程序编译和链接更为顺畅。 2. **第二课:工程和目标文件的显示与定制** - 学习如何管理和组织项目,包括创建、查看和调整工程设置,以适应不同项目的需求。 3. **第三课:编译** - 在这一课中,用户会了解如何使用CodeWarrior对源代码进行编译,确保语法正确且符合标准。 4. **第四课:链接** - 学习链接阶段,即连接各个编译后的模块,形成可执行文件的过程,这对于程序的完整性和性能至关重要。 5. **第五课:调试** - CodeWarrior强大的调试功能在此处详细介绍,包括断点设置、单步执行、变量监视等,帮助定位和解决问题。 6. **第六课:定制** - 包括设置和配置CodeWarrior的工作环境,以优化开发过程,如添加自定义编译选项、设置构建规则等。 7. **第七课:库函数与Microsoft Foundation Classes (MFC)** - MFC是Microsoft提供的一个用于快速开发Windows应用程序的框架,这里会讲解如何利用库函数和MFC进行高级编程。 作为初学者,可以从创建简单应用程序(如文本编辑器)开始,然后逐步进阶到复杂商业软件的开发。尽管教程主要集中在Windows平台,但许多概念和技巧也可应用于其他平台,特别是对于Mac应用程序的开发也具有指导意义。通过学习和实践,开发者能够掌握高效的开发工具,从而提高自己的编程能力和产品质量。